Blooming good Southampton

8:50am Friday 30th July 2010

JUDGING has begun in this year’s Southampton in Bloom competition.

Judges and committee members gathered to compare notes on the 186 entries aiming to bring a splash of colour to the city.

The recent dry spell has been bad news for gardeners though and a number of entries have been removed this year because of parched lawns and wilting plants.

Southampton in Bloom co-ordinator Hilary Bradley said: “We will be making allowances this year as we had a harsh winter and a cold spring, and for the considerate conservation of water.”
